Electrician Diploma, Certificate and Degree Options<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"WyomingThere are three general options to get electrician training in a trade or technical school near Wyoming NY. You may enroll in a certificate or diploma program, or receive an Associate Degree. Bachelor’s Degrees are obtainable at a few schools, but are not as common as the first three options. In many cases these programs are offered together with an apprenticeship program, which are required by the majority of states in order to be licensed or if you want to earn certification.
